KATHMANDU, Jan 9: Hamad International Airport (HIA) has been rated as a '5-Star Airport' by a London-based aviation institute, Skytrax.
According to a press release issued by the company, it is the sixth airport to receive the award after Singapore, Seoul, Hong Kong, Tokyo-Haneda and Munich.
The release said that the company has been awarded for its excellent facilities for customers combined with high quality airport staff service.
HIA has already received Skytrax Middle East's Best Airport in 2015 and 2016, Skytrax Best Staff Service in the Middle East 2016 and previously Best Airport Award at the Future Travel Experience (FTE) Asia Awards in 2015, the release added.
